OverviewTaylor & Francis Group have an exciting opportunity for a Marketing Analytics Manager to join the Marketing Analytics team. We're looking for an individual who has a real curiosity about patterns in data and a passion for turning those patterns into actionable commercial information. This role would suit someone who is highly numerate with exceptional analytics skills, alongside the ability to communicate their insight to the wider business and make commercial recommendations. You'll be kept busy managing some of your own projects as well as supporting the rest of the team in ensuring that the Marketing department have the analytics and insights required to actively support their budget, targets and strategy planning. Responsibilities
Supporting the Marketing team to make strategic, data first decisions by: Designing and optimising marketing reporting and dashboards, enabling marketers to independently make evidence-based decisions. Creating regular reports and presentations for stakeholders on marketing performance and recommendations. Supporting A/B test initiatives to enhance conversion rates and customer engagement. Conducting analysis and creating actionable insights to drive marketing performance including:
Campaign and channel tracking Benchmarking and goal setting Customer behaviour and segmentation
Developing in-house training for campaign analysis and reporting. Source and integrate data for accurate reporting, collaborating with Technology and other analytics teams to define marketing reporting requirements and maintain data quality. Line-management of junior members in the team. Highly numerate with advanced level Excel.
Qualifications and experience
Knowledge and experience in data manipulation, data visualisation and report creation, ideally in Power BI. Advanced knowledge of Google Analytics. Experience in SQL. Experience in working with marketing, customer and sales data. Experience in A/B testing, knowledge of other statistical modelling techniques. A focus on commercial results and making evidence-based decisions. Problem solving and strategic thinking ability. Outstanding communication and presentation skills to create compelling insights and recommendations at all organisational levels. A focus on learning and self-development. Experience with the following would be beneficial: Alteryx, Python, R, BigQuery, Marketing Cloud, Sprinklr, Contentsquare, Google Tag Manager.
